This is an application under Section 439 of the Cr.P.C. for bail in CR No. 172/2016 dated 9.11.2016 registered with Vishnunagar Police Station, Dombivali, District Thane under Sections 406, 419, 420, 465, 469, 471 of the Indian Penal Code and under Section 39 of the Maharashtra Money Lending Act. 2.
Heard the learned counsel for the applicant and the learned APP. Perused the charge sheet.
3.
The applicant is accused No.1 in the present crime. 4.
The prosecution case in brief is that, the applicant printed his visiting cards and it is stated therein that, he is concerned with All India Human Rights Association and KGK Page-1/3
Associates. It is alleged that the accused No.2 Smt. Kushala i.e. the wife of the applicant by giving false assurances to the needy persons that, she will be able to procure loan at reasonable rates, accepted substantial amount from the needy persons and subsequently defalcated it. It is further alleged that, the said accused Smt. Kushala on her letter head printed symbol of Advocate's thereby depicting that she is a practicing Advocate. The accused No.2 Smt. Kushala after winning confidence from the people induced them to deposit money with her and subsequently defalcated the said amount. It is further alleged that, accused No.2 defalcated an amount of approximately Rs.76.00 lakhs in toto.
4.
The record indicates that, the applicant is beneficiary of sum of Rs.7,77,000/- out of the said total proceeds of the crime. In furtherance of the Order dated 11.7.2018 the learned counsel for the applicant has tendered across the bar affidavit of the applicant dated 14.7.2018 duly affirmed before the Superintendent of Kalyan District Prison. It is stated in the affidavit that out of the total amount of Rs.7,77,000 an amount of Rs.2.00 lakhs will be paid within a period of two weeks from today to show his bonafide in the registry of this Court and the Page-2/3
balance amount of Rs.5,77,000/- will be deposited in the registry of this Court within a period of six months from today. The said affidavit is taken on record and marked "X" for identification. In view of the said affidavit filed by the applicant and without going into the merits of the matter, I am inclined to release the applicant on bail.
Hence, the following order.
a) The applicant shall be released on bail in CR No. No. I172/2017 dated 9.11.2016 registered with Vishunagar Police Station, Dombivli, District Thane on his furnishing PR bond of Rs.25,000/- with one or two solvent local sureties in the like amount.
b) After is release from Jail, the applicant shall attend the concerned police station on every first Monday of the month between 11.00 a.m. to 1.00p.m.
c) The applicant shall attend all the dates before the Trial Court unless precluded for medical reasons.
d) The applicant shall not tamper with the evidence and /or influence the prosecution witnesses.
